My original question:

 Hi all.

I need a little help. My work consists in network monitoring. I need

to inform a remote user too when some event happens. The remote user

is reachable through a pager.

Has anyone developed a perl or java routine to send a alphanumeric string

to a pager ?

Here the answer:

1) There are a number of pager companies who allow you to send pages

   via an email message top teir service.

   For example: pager@link.com.au or PIN@pagemci.com

2) There are some free programs:

   BigBrother -> http://www.iti.qc.ca/users/sean/bb-dnld/index.html

                 http://iti-s01.iti.qc.ca/users/sean/bb-dnld/

   Swatch

   Ixo

   Tpage

   Sendpage

   Qpager

   WhatsUP http://www.ipswitch.com

3) Moore William send me a perl script that works a series of log

   data

It seems that a java routine do not exist !
